| SIDES
SLIDES TO “SIX NATIONS SHOWDOWN” VICTORY AT
OHSWEKEN |
by
Tommy Goudge (July 29, 2009) – It seems
Jason Sides has taken a liking to Ohsweken
Speedway. The Bartlett, Tennessee driver
claimed his second feature win in three career
starts at the three-eighths mile clay oval on
Wednesday night during the second running of
the World of Outlaws Sprint Car series “Six
Nations Showdown”. In ESSO Mini Stock
action, Steve Hess held off a determined
Trevor Goulding to claim his first feature win
of the season.
Jason Meyers and Craig Dollansky started the
thirty lap World of Outlaws feature on the
front row, and it was Dollansky jumping out to
the early lead, while Sides got by Meyers for
the runner-up spot before the first lap was
completed. With three laps completed, the
caution flag flew for the stopped machine of
Dave Dykstra in turn four.
Back under green, Sides began to put the
pressure on Dollansky, and made what would
turn out to be the winning move coming out of
turn four on the sixth lap. That move very
nearly resulted in disaster as Sides used a
slide job on Dollansky to take the lead, and
the two made contact in the process. Dollansky
did well to hang on and stay within striking
distance of Sides, while lapped traffic loomed
ahead. Another caution flag on lap ten gave
Sides a clear track, but an open red flag on
lap sixteen for a Brian Ellenberger rollover
allowed all of the teams to work on their
cars. Many drivers and teams had planned for
the track to dry out as the feature wore on,
but the Ohsweken clay had other ideas, forcing
them to adjust accordingly.
Back under green again, Sides got off to a
strong start and was back in lapped traffic
quickly. Donny Schatz was one of the drivers
who made changes during the break, and was
very competitive in the second half of the
event, but a prolonged battle with Dollansky
over the runner-up spot cost him too much
time, and Sides was able to cruise to the
victory without a serious challenge. Schatz
settled for second, while Dollansky finished
third, followed by Jason Meyers, Jac
Haudenschild, Lucas Wolfe, Cody Darrah, Danny
Lasoski, Kraig Kinser, and Steve Kinser, who
finished outside of the top four in Canada for
the first time in his long and distinguished
career.
Four track records were broken on the fast
Ohsweken surface on Wednesday night, including
Joey Saldana with a new time trial record of
12.420 seconds in qualifying for the
thirty-nine car field, while Jason Meyers set
eight lap heat race and six lap dash race
records, and Wayne Johnson completed the
twelve lap B-Main in record time. Heat race
victories were claimed by Dollansky, Meyers,
Daryn Pittman, and Schatz.
Wyatt Van Wart and Mike Taylor started the
ESSO Mini Stock feature on the front row, but
all eyes were on division points leader
Mitchell Brown, who started outside row two.
Trevor Goulding and Steve Hess quickly moved
up as well, and would become the focus of
attention later in the event after Brown
dropped out. Goulding and Hess spent much of
the last half of the fifteen lap feature
side-by-side, but it was Hess coming out with
the victory after a close call in lapped
traffic with the white flag flying. Goulding
would hold on for the runner-up spot, followed
by Kevin Hilborn, Matt Deschamps, and Ethan
Martin. Heat race victories for the nineteen
car field were claimed by Deschamps and
Goulding.
